Sammy Morris is still going to be out a little while longer for the New England Patriots
The New England Patriots will be without Sammy Morris for a couple of more weeks as he recovers from his torn MCL. Morris has played in 6 games this season for the Patriots and he has carried the ball 30 times for 109 yards (3.6 ypc) with 1 TD run. He has also caught 12 passes for 137 yards (11.4 avg) so far this season. The Patriots can’t wait to get Morris back as Coach Belichick loves having depth at running back.
